AI has been gaining attention due to its potential to cause widespread disruption in the workforce, with up to 300 million full-time jobs across the globe estimated to be automated in some way by the newest wave of AI. While white-collar workers are likely to be more affected than manual laborers, AI is not always better, faster or cheaper and can make mistakes and produce false information. Some experts suggest a future in which AI can assist humans rather than replace them entirely, while in other industries, AI may have little to no impact at all.
